I'm looking into buying a 71 chevy that if i get i will be parting out. I will be needing to make my money back on it pretty quick in order to go on vacation in May. I'm looking at the truck mainly for some of the a/c stuff and the price is right. So here is the right down of what it is. It's a 71 chevy 1/2 ton 2wd. % bolt with power front discs, one legger rear end. The box is shot but it did have a wood floor. The front bumper is perfect to what i could see. Interior wasn't too bad. lots of good little parts. I think the front fenders were decent. Good inner grill. I think the tailgate was in pretty good shape. The underside wasn't terrible. Typical iowa truck. It has the orignal 350 and Th 350 in it. It also has air. Dieselwrencher has first dibs on air parts and front end parts, if i get it.

Like i said i haven't bought it yet, just need to know if there is enough interest in parts to make it worth my while. Stuff will also be listed on the local CL if i do buy it. So let me know. need to make my decision before friday.

Also checking interest in a 72 I think cheyenne. Non air. About the only options is body mouldings, power steering and power disc brakes. Also its supposed to have a posi in it. Again it has the original 350 and Th 350 in it.
